云服務(wù)器怎么安裝數據庫
隨著(zhù)云計算技術(shù)的云服不斷發(fā)展,越(?⊿?)來(lái)越多的安裝企業(yè)和個(gè)人選擇將數據存儲在云服務(wù)器上,云服務(wù)器提供了靈活、數據可擴展的云服計算資源,使得我們可以輕松地搭建和管理各種應用??,安裝數據庫作為應用的數據核心組件之一,其安裝和配置顯得尤為重要,云服本文將詳細介紹如何在云服務(wù)器上安裝數據庫。安裝
我們需要確定要安裝的數據庫類(lèi)型,常見(jiàn)的云服數據庫類(lèi)型有MySQL、PostgreSQL、安裝MongoDB、數據Redis等,云服不同的安裝數據庫類(lèi)型有不同的特點(diǎn)和應用場(chǎng)景,因此我們需要根據自己的數據需求來(lái)選擇合適的數據庫,如果我們需要一個(gè)關(guān)系型數據庫來(lái)存儲結構化數據,那么My??SQL或PostgreSQL可能是一個(gè)不錯的選擇;如果我們需要一個(gè)高性能的鍵值存儲數據庫,那么Redis可能ヽ(′?`)ノ更適合我們。
2. 登錄云服務(wù)器
3. 安裝數據庫
對于Linux系統,我們可以使用包管理器來(lái)安裝數據庫,以MyS??QL為例,我們可以執行以下命令來(lái)安裝MySQL:
sudo apt-get updatesudo apt-ge(′▽?zhuān)?t install mysql-server對于Windows系統,我們可以從官方網(wǎng)站下載對應的安裝包,然后運行安裝程序進(jìn)行安裝。
4. 配置數據庫
安裝完成后,我們需要對數據庫進(jìn)行配置,這包括設置root用戶(hù)??的密碼、創(chuàng )建新用戶(hù)、分配權限等,以MySQL為例,我們可以執行以下命令來(lái)進(jìn)行配置:
sudo mysql_secヾ(′?`)?ure_??installation
這個(gè)命令會(huì )引導??我們完成一系列的安全設置,包括設置root密碼、禁止遠程root登錄、刪除匿名用戶(hù)等,完成配置后,我們就可以使用新創(chuàng )ヽ(′▽?zhuān)?ノ建的用戶(hù)和密碼來(lái)登錄數據庫了。
5. 啟動(dòng)和停止數據庫服務(wù)
在安裝了數據庫并進(jìn)行了配置后,我們可以使用以下命令來(lái)啟動(dòng)和停止數據庫服務(wù):
對于Linux系統:(′▽?zhuān)?
sudo service mysql start # 啟動(dòng)MySQL服務(wù)sudo service mysql stop # 停止MySQL服務(wù)對于Windows系統:
net start mysql # 啟動(dòng)MySQL服務(wù)net stop mysql # 停止MySQ(′;ω;`)L服務(wù)
為了保證數據的安全性,我們需要定期對數據庫進(jìn)行備份,如果發(fā)生數據丟(′_`)失或損壞的(de)情況,我們還需要進(jìn)行數據恢復,以MySQL為例,我們可以使用`mys??qldump`命令來(lái)備份ヽ(′▽?zhuān)?ノ數據庫,使用`mysql`命令來(lái)恢復數據庫。
sudo mysqldump -u root -p mydatabase > mydatabase_backup.sql # 備份mydatabase數據庫sudo mysql -u root -p < mydatabase_backup.sql # 恢復mydatabase數據庫
7. 監控和管理數據庫性能
為(?Д?)了確保數據庫的穩定運行,我們需要對數據庫的性能進(jìn)行監控和管理,這包括查看數據庫的狀態(tài)、診斷性能問(wèn)題、優(yōu)化查詢(xún)等,以MySQL為例,我們可以使用??`mysqladmin`命令來(lái)查看數據庫的狀態(tài),使用`explain`命令來(lái)分析查詢(xún)性能,使用`optimize table`命令來(lái)優(yōu)化表結構等。
sudo mysqladminヽ(′▽?zhuān)?ノ status -u root -p # 查看MySQL狀態(tài)EXPLAIN SELECT * FROM mytable; # 分析查詢(xún)性能OPTIMIZE TABLE myt??able; # 優(yōu)化表結構
通過(guò)以上步驟,我們就可??以在云服務(wù)器上成功安裝和配置數據庫了,不同的數據庫類(lèi)型和操作系統可能會(huì )有所不同,我們需要根據實(shí)際情況進(jìn)行調整,希望本文能對您有所幫助!